I am an electrician. The black and red are the hots. The white is the nuetral. The bare wire is the ground. You need 10-2 wire if you use romex for the cord and you use the black and white for the hots. If you use an extension cord or SJO cord, you need 10-3, as it is rated by the number of wires in it.
SJO cord is a heavy duty, very flexible cord that can take a lot of abuse.
By the way, so you know, #12 wire is rated for 20 amps, #10 for 30 amps.
